Decathlon

The French company, Decathlon, is a vertically integrated sporting goods retailer. It owns research, design and production of its brands, and sells them through its stores. This lets it reduce middleman markups and keep prices affordable for sports fans.

Decathlon is also committed to inclusiveness in sport. It hopes to reach a broader range of athletes through offering affordable gear and doing so without cutting corners on performance or quality. It also innovates by partnering with ingredient brands to enhance its products. For instance, it recently introduced infrared technology that helps athletes see better.

However, it could be difficult for Decathlon to compete with REI, Cabela's, and Walmart. The sheer number of tents, hiking shoes puffy jackets, puffy coats, and badminton rackets could make it confusing for customers to decide what product is best for them.

Decathlon's U.S. operation will therefore be primarily focused on outdoor equipment. The company is also constructing more "test-and-buy" facilities in its stores around the world. Selfridges

Selfridges is an excellent shopping destination if you want a premium experience. This London department store has everything you need to purchase high-end fashions, luxury brands and designer gems. This is a great place to relax and enjoy an extravagant experience.

The entrepreneur behind the Selfridges, Harry Gordon Selfridge set out to make shopping a leisure activity and to bring a sense of consumerism to the UK. The first store he established in Oxford Street was a huge success, and was renowned for its elaborate window displays. He supported the Suffragette Movement and did not allow activists to smash his windows.
